I think one of the main themes here at Ooorah, in my inbox, and probably even in your minds this month has been, "What the heck is decopunk?"

To go from such a well-known subgenre of scifi such as Space Opera--the Pappa, the Grandaddy of them all--to decopunk--the small, red-headed, quiet cousin in the corner--may seem like a disservice to the subgenre itself.

But as you see, you just leafed through a combination of short stories, articles, and the best installment of Smith & Jones to date (that ones for you, AngusEcrivain). Their common theme? The small, shiny, good-can-be-bad subgenre, decopunk.

For me, this issue made me think. Over and over as I read, proofed, and reread these entries, my interests were piqued by the shininess of the genre, even in the midst of tragic events. Picture if you will, a family of four sitting down to a nice dinner, woefully ignoring the bomb going off outside their own window.

This, to me, is the essence of decopunk. It leaves me wondering, pondering. I think all of us have a little space in our head where decopunk resides. Perhaps this issue made you dust the cobwebs off the door in your own mind and step on in.
